They have a shiny gray sheen to their coats and are the

lightest color

a pug can be. Silver-fawn pugs are pretty rare , and many who have them categorize them as fawns, instead of silver-fawns.

Silver Pugs Worth: How much are silver pugs worth

The

average cost

of a Pug will range anywhere between $500 to $1,200 USD , with the highest in the stratosphere of $2,500 USD and up. However, the price of a Pug tends to vary greatly based on the

blood line

, breeder reputation, location and coat color.

Platinum Pug: What is a platinum pug

Platinum Pugs are a deep, dark grey They are distinctly darker than fawn-silver Pugs and not as dark as purebred

black pugs

. Some very smutty fawn or silver Pugs are often passed off as Platinum Pugs by unscrupulous breeders.

Colour Pug: What Colour pug is better

The black gene is the strongest and will rule over any other color, it is the dominant gene. This may lead you to wonder why there are more fawn Pugs than black ones. The main reason is that breeders choose more often to produce fawns.

Pugs Aggressive: Are pugs aggressive

Though Pugs can be very friendly and loving, they can become aggressive when not properly socialized Aggression in Pugs is often manifested in barking, lunging, nipping, or growling. Pugs may be trying to establish dominance within a space that they feel is their territory through this behavior.

How old do pugs live?


Pugs:

Pugs live an average of 10-14 years However, given their ability to gain weight quickly and their overall respiratory issues, many pugs don’t live longer than 15 years. Like many different species of animals, most female pugs live longer than male pugs.

Why pugs are expensive?


Expensive:

Pugs are expensive because they are a pedigree breed, have small litters, will often need a costly C-section to give birth, can have complications during and after pregnancy, and are in

high demand

This means the breeders can charge high amounts, plus have expensive vet bills to pay for.

Can pugs have white on them?


White:

Many black Pugs have solid coats, but it is possible for there to be a small white marking ; if this is present, it is usually on the chest. As Pugs age into their senior years, gray hairs may appear on the face or in different areas of the body and this is much more noticeable with black Pugs.

Black Pug: Why is my black pug turning white

Sometimes, the reason your dog’s fur is turning white is a condition call vitiligo Vitiligo is a rare skin condition that can cause pigment loss in certain patches of skin and fur. While the causes of vitiligo are unknown, many scientists believe that the condition is hereditary.

Do pugs go GREY early?


Grey:

Dogs with high levels of psychological stress or anxiety have been found to grey earlier, and the cellular stress that causes grey hairs has a genetic component in dogs. On average most dogs start going grey around 5 years old, though some start going grey before the age of 2.

Merle Dogs Healthy: Are merle dogs healthy

Yes – merle dogs can be just as healthy as dogs that have a solid color They have the same life expectancy, they are just as strong and athletic and smart as their counterparts without the merle gene. In lines with responsible merle breedings, all offspring will be healthy and live a long life.

Double Merle: How do I know if my dog is double merle

Dogs with the double merle gene may be/have: All white in color, or have patches of merle/mottled coloring on the top half of their body – their head, back, and base of the tail. Light-colored paw pads. Have light blue, green or brown eyes, perhaps even eyes that are different colors.
